Here's a detailed explanation for the SAP error message WS_TOOL404: UDDI TModel entry in registry &: Error Message WS_TOOL404: UDDI TModel entry in registry & Cause This error occurs when the SAP Web Service tool tries to access or reference a UDDI TModel entry in the UDDI registry, but the specified TModel entry is not found or does not exist in the UDDI registry. UDDI (Universal Description, Discovery, and Integration) is a platform-independent framework for describing services, discovering businesses, and integrating business services using the Internet. A TModel (Technical Model) in UDDI is a data structure that represents a technical specification or a service type. The error indicates that the TModel ID or key that the SAP system is trying to use or look up is missing or invalid in the UDDI registry.
